Ahoy, Arlo... Just out of curiosity, are you running the game, patched with a 4 GB patch, or using Large Address Aware or LAA, as some (like Myself, like to refer to it by.. ) - (which to Me, is the simplest method).

Either of these will assign your computer to assign the SH4.exe 4 GB's of RAM, rather than the nominal 1 or 2 GB's.

As it is, it sounds like you are running it without. Which can also contribute to CTD's, as well.

Hope this info helps...

LAA is easy to find, just google for it, d/l & install.. (standard install is fine (C:\Program files) works.. after that, is just a simple 3 step process to run it:

1 After opening, do a search for your SH4.exe you need to tell it to allow for 4 GB's of RAM to be used by it.

2. Make sure the box is check marked to assign SH4.exe

3. Click ok or accept, to finalize the process... & Done.

Couldn't be any easier...
